Understanding Jakarta's Creative Economy Surge
In a remarkable display of growth, Jakarta's creative economy has achieved a staggering Rp55 billion in transactions, reflecting a vibrant ecosystem thriving on innovation and digital advancement. This surge not only highlights the resilience of local businesses but also marks a significant turning point in Indonesia's economic narrative. With a population exceeding 270 million, Indonesia is positioned as a leader in the Southeast Asian economic landscape, and the creative sector plays a crucial role in driving this growth.
The Rise of Digital Platforms
One of the key contributors to this impressive figure is the rapid adoption of digital platforms across various creative sectors. From digital art and content creation to e-commerce and entertainment, the ecosystem is evolving. Businesses are leveraging technology to connect with consumers more effectively, creating lucrative opportunities that were previously untapped. This trend mirrors global shifts towards digitalization, with Indonesia's creative industries poised to compete on a larger scale.
Impact on Local Businesses
As local entrepreneurs engage more in creative innovations, we witness an influx of unique products and services tailored to meet the demands of a diverse market. This has led to increased visibility for many small and medium enterprises (SMEs) in Jakarta, encouraging a shift from traditional business models to more agile and responsive strategies that cater to consumer trends. The local government has also implemented supportive policies to foster this environment.
